A Postgraduate Certificate in Security Architecture for Planners equips professionals with the advanced knowledge and skills needed to design and implement robust security systems within diverse environments. This specialized program focuses on integrating security considerations from the initial planning stages of a project, minimizing vulnerabilities and maximizing effectiveness.
Learning outcomes include a comprehensive understanding of risk assessment methodologies, security technologies (such as access control systems and cybersecurity protocols), and legal frameworks related to security planning. Graduates will be proficient in developing detailed security plans, managing security projects, and communicating effectively with stakeholders regarding security implications. The curriculum covers physical security, cybersecurity, and critical infrastructure protection.
The duration of the Postgraduate Certificate typically ranges from six months to a year, depending on the institution and mode of delivery (full-time or part-time). The program often includes a combination of lectures, workshops, and practical assignments to foster a deep understanding of security architecture principles.
